HIP 96176

HIP 96176 is a M-type (Red) star located in the constellation Sagittarius.

At a distance of roughly 1,125 light-years, HIP 96176 is a distant star lying deep within the Milky Way galaxy.

HIP 96176 is classified as a spectral class M star (M-type (Red)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

HIP 96176 has an apparent magnitude of +7.66,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its red h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+1.624.
